“The Ultimate Fighter 29” winner Bryan Battle will drop to 170 pounds for a matchup with Takashi Sato at  UFC on ESPN 40.

Both fighters confirmed the booking on social media following an initial report from  MMAFighting.com. UFC on ESPN 40 takes place on Aug. 6 at an an as yet to be announced location and is headlined by a light heavyweight showdown between Jamahal Hill and Thiago Santos.

Both of Battle’s first two promotional triumphs have come at middleweight. The 27-year-old Hayastan MMA Charlotte representative submitted Gilbert Urbina at UFC on ESPN 30 to complete his run through “TUF 29” and then outpointed Tresean Gore in his second Octagon appearance at UFC Fight Night 200. Battle has currently won six straight professional outings overall.

Sato, meanwhile, has lost three of his last four UFC appearances. Most recently, the Sanford MMA member dropped a unanimous verdict to Gunnar Nelson at UFC Fight Night 204 on March 19. The Pancrase veteran is 15-5 as a pro, with 13 wins coming inside the distance.
